Faeces vs. Shit

What's the Difference?

Faeces and shit are both terms used to describe waste matter that is excreted from the body. While they are often used interchangeably, there is a slight difference in connotation between the two. Faeces is a more clinical term, typically used in medical or scientific contexts, while shit is a more colloquial and informal term. Both refer to the same substance, but the choice of word can convey different levels of formality or vulgarity.
